William of Ockham was an English Franciscan friar and philosopher, widely known for Occam's razor.

History[edit]

During a discussion about the strange behavior of Springfield's adults, Lisa Simpson referenced Ockham's razor, the philosophical principle associated with William of Ockham. Attempting to dismiss conspiracy theories involving UFOs and secret plots, Lisa argued that “the simplest explanation is probably the correct one.” Her efforts failed when the other children instead became convinced that “reverse vampires” were responsible.
